1

Тема: Вывод виджетов и др. код через дополнительные поля

Здравствуйте, возникла проблема, хочу через доп. поле выводить на нужные страницы нужные мне виджеты, когда вставляю виджет в доп. поле, он не срабатывает, возможно ли такая конструкция? Если да, то как это сделать?

Пытаюсь так:

{include_tpl('{$page.field_code}')}

так:

{widget('{$page.field_code}')}

Пробовал наоборот, в файле page_full оставлять {$page.field_code}

в доп. поле вставлять:

{include_tpl('{$page.field_code}')} и {widget('{$page.field_code}')}

Не выводится...

Бла-бла-бла

Thumbs up Thumbs down

2

Re: Вывод виджетов и др. код через дополнительные поля

Попробуйте такую конструкцию:

Создайте текстовое доп. поле (к примеру field_page_widget).
В админке страницы в этом поле пишите название виджета (к примеру вместо {widget('my_widget')}, пишем my_widget).
В шаблоне страницы {widget($page.field_page_widget)}

Разрабатываю модули для ImageCMS Corporate (оплата PayPal).

3

Re: Вывод виджетов и др. код через дополнительные поля

Ух ты... заработало, спасибо!

Бла-бла-бла

Thumbs up Thumbs down